Producer Ektaa Kapoor recently opened up about the opposition she faced from her parents when she launched the OTT platform ALTT (formerly ALTBalaji), which was known for hosting bold and adult-oriented content. The platform had initially generated significant attention for targeting an 18+ audience with original shows exploring themes such as crime, youth culture and sexuality. However, it later ran into controversy and was banned by the Government of India in 2025 over allegations of streaming obscene and vulgar content that did not comply with legal guidelines.

During a recent interaction with Usha Kakade Productions, Kapoor revealed that both her parents — veteran actor Jeetendra and producer Shobha Kapoor — were strongly against the idea of launching the platform.
“My mom and dad did not want me to start the ALTT. They thought that since I am a Padma Shri recipient and I have an image in the industry, I should not start an app of bold content. We had a lot of fight in our house regarding this, but I thought that since I have done a lot of family content, I should do different content which involves youth, crime, bold – something that works on every platform. So I started it, but I did not get any support from my house,” she said.
Kapoor further recalled that her parents would repeatedly urge her to shut the platform down and often taunted her about the decision. “They would target four taunts at me as I refused to get marriage but in this case I had to hear 100 taunts. From the morning they would start telling me to close the platform – Band kar Do, band kar do. Eventually me and my mom resigned, but I got maximum taunts for this and my dad and mom became my saas (mother-in-law) when it came to this thing,” she added.
In 2025, the Ministry of Information and Broadcasting blacklisted ALTT along with several other OTT websites, including ULLU, Desiflix and Big Shots, citing the streaming of objectionable content. Following the reports, Kapoor issued a clarification stating that she and her mother were no longer associated with ALTT. Both had stepped down from their roles in June 2021.
